Dilip Yadav is a scholar working on Molecular Biology, Renewable Energy, Sustainability and the Environment and Pediatrics, Perinatology and Child Health. According to data from OpenAlex, Dilip Yadav has authored 13 papers receiving a total of 152 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Molecular Biology, 4 papers in Renewable Energy, Sustainability and the Environment and 3 papers in Pediatrics, Perinatology and Child Health. Recurrent topics in Dilip Yadav's work include Photovoltaic System Optimization Techniques (4 papers), Solar Thermal and Photovoltaic Systems (4 papers) and Birth, Development, and Health (3 papers). Dilip Yadav is often cited by papers focused on Photovoltaic System Optimization Techniques (4 papers), Solar Thermal and Photovoltaic Systems (4 papers) and Birth, Development, and Health (3 papers). Dilip Yadav collaborates with scholars based in India, United Kingdom and United States. Dilip Yadav's co-authors include Nidhi Singh, Smeeta Shrestha, Giriraj R. Chandak, Vikas Singh Bhadoria, Karen A. Lillycrop, Caroline Fall, Chittaranjan S. Yajnik, Adwait Anand Godbole, Joanna D. Holbrook and Wei Ding and has published in prestigious journals such as SHILAP Revista de lepidopterología, American Journal of Clinical Nutrition and IEEE Access.
